Perhaps, out of all the controversies tied to Sarah Ferguson, her alleged obsession with the occasional tipple may be the least of her woes. Long before she became synonymous with Jeffrey Epstein, the former Duchess of York was known for her party-girl persona in the 1990s, frequently photographed with a drink at glamorous soirées. It was at one such Christmas gathering that royal commentator Andrew Pierce claims he had to step in after she reportedly made a dramatic beeline for a waiter carrying a tray of booze.

At the time, Ferguson was newly divorced from Andrew Mountbatten-Windsor and allegedly struggling with financial difficulties. Commenting on the same, GB News presenter Pierce said on the Suddenly Single podcast, "She [Sarah] is a reckless spender. That's her problem." Speaking about his encounter with her at a Christmas gathering, he alleged, "Sarah Ferguson was there, and then a waiter in all his finery walked past with a tray of drinks. Sarah Ferguson went charging after him as if to get some wine. And I said: 'Sarah, you're not going to run out of alcohol at this party. There's going to be enough for all of us. It's got one of the finest wine cellars in London."

According to Pierce, the Christmas party was held in London's upmarket Lowndes Square with "all sorts of posh people there." However, he believed it was highly unlikely that Ferguson would ever be invited to such a party again, especially after her sketchy friendship with Epstein came to light. He scoffed. "She [Sarah] has taken herself off the social circuit completely. She's hanging her head in shame." In email exchanges released in the Epstein files, the former Duchess asked the disgraced financier for monetary help, even requesting $27,000 to cover her rent, while elsewhere suggesting she take on a role as his housekeeper for a salary of around $335,000.

Interestingly, Ferguson has spoken about her problems with alcohol, once admitting 'she was in the gutter,' to Oprah Winfrey in 2010. She said, "I haven't faced the devil in the face. Because I was in the gutter at that moment. I'm aware of the fact that I've been drinking, you know – that I was not in my right place," while speaking about the aftermath her infamous 'cash for access' deal, where she fell for two sting operators asking her for access to her ex-husband in exchange for money. Footage from the operation also showed her drinking, smoking, and slurring with her words. 

That scandal pales in comparison to the controversy she is embroiled in now, which has cost her her royal titles and access to the Royal Lodge. She faced immense backlash after leaked emails revealed her unusual exchanges with Epstein, including one message in which she jokingly suggested he should 'marry' her. Moreover, she reportedly took her young daughters, Princess Beatrice and Princess Eugenie, to lunch with him after his release from jail for indecent crimes against minors.
